野生雀形目鸟类精子竞争减弱时精子形态的选择

Selection on sperm morphology under relaxed sperm competition in a wild passerine bird.

作者信息

Calhim Sara, Lampe Helene M, Slagsvold Tore, Birkhead Tim R

机构信息

Department of Animal & Plant Sciences, University of Sheffield, Western Bank, Sheffield, S10 2TN, UK.

出版信息

Biol Lett. 2009 Feb 23;5(1):58-61. doi: 10.1098/rsbl.2008.0544.

DOI:10.1098/rsbl.2008.0544
PMID:18986959
原文链接:https://pmc.ncbi.nlm.nih.gov/articles/PMC2657760/
Abstract

Theories regarding the role of sexual selection on the evolution of sperm traits are based on an association between pre-copulatory (e.g. female preference) and post-copulatory (e.g. ejaculate quality) male reproductive traits. In tests of these hypotheses, sperm morphology has rarely been used, despite its high heritability and intra-individual consistency. We found evidence of selection for longer sperm through positive phenotypic associations between sperm size and the two major female preference traits in the pied flycatcher, Ficedula hypoleuca. Our results support the sexually selected sperm hypothesis in a species under low sperm competition and demonstrate that natural and pre-copulatory sexual selection forces should not be overlooked in studies of intraspecific sperm morphology evolution.

摘要

关于性选择在精子性状进化中作用的理论,是基于交配前(如雌性偏好)和交配后(如射精质量)雄性生殖性状之间的关联。在这些假说的检验中,尽管精子形态具有高遗传性和个体内一致性,但很少被使用。我们通过雄性斑姬鹟(Ficedula hypoleuca)精子大小与雌性两个主要偏好性状之间的正表型关联,发现了对更长精子进行选择的证据。我们的结果支持了低精子竞争物种中的性选择精子假说,并表明在种内精子形态进化研究中,自然选择和交配前性选择力量不应被忽视。
